This delightful and popular old coastal town is situated on the north coast of kent 12 km from Canterbury, 29 km from Dover and 100 km from London. Whitstable has plenty of charm and character with fisherman's huts and pretty weatherboard cottages. Historic harbour. Shingle/sandy beaches where you can enjoy sunbathing, swimming and watersports. Here the Thames estuary broadens into the North sea and the town nestles alongside a sheltered bay formed between the Kent shoreline and the Isle of Sheppey. As a fishing port, Whitstable is famous for its oysters - there is a festival every July. There are many shops, pubs, restaurants specialising in seafood. Art galleries.
